I'm experiencing a similar issue: when calling EPG, Kodi 15 crashes. There were no such issues in Kodi 14, they only began after upgrade to Kodi 15.
Anyone have any ideas how to resolve? I've tried clearing EPG cache, and PVR cache but to no avail.
Part of crash log:
############### Kodi CRASH LOG ###############
################ SYSTEM INFO ################
Date: Thu Jul 23 18:55:33 BST 2015
Kodi Options:
Arch: x86_64
Kernel: Linux 3.16.0-44-generic #59~14.04.1-Ubuntu SMP Tue Jul 7 15:07:27 UTC 2015
Release: Ubuntu 14.04.2 LTS, Trusty Tahr
############## END SYSTEM INFO ##############
############### STACK TRACE #################
=====> Core file: /home/lounge/core (2015-07-23 18:55:33.133867439 +0100)
=========================================
[New LWP 19420]
[New LWP 19426]
[New LWP 19438]
[New LWP 19441]
[New LWP 19424]
[New LWP 19434]
[New LWP 19423]
[New LWP 19474]
[New LWP 19458]
[New LWP 19447]
[New LWP 19444]
[New LWP 19465]
[New LWP 19475]
[New LWP 19559]
[New LWP 19464]
[New LWP 19489]
[New LWP 19491]
[New LWP 19445]
[New LWP 19561]
[New LWP 19472]
[New LWP 19477]
[New LWP 19492]
[New LWP 19558]
[New LWP 19566]
[New LWP 19468]
[New LWP 19478]
[New LWP 19451]
[New LWP 19567]
[New LWP 19457]
[New LWP 19482]
[New LWP 19568]
[New LWP 19493]
[New LWP 19440]
[New LWP 19480]
[New LWP 19563]
[New LWP 19806]
[New LWP 19467]
[New LWP 19488]
[New LWP 19439]
[New LWP 19481]
[New LWP 19454]
[New LWP 19435]
[New LWP 19564]
[New LWP 19466]
[New LWP 19552]
[New LWP 19565]
[New LWP 19503]
[New LWP 19547]
[New LWP 19506]
[New LWP 19496]
[New LWP 19495]
[New LWP 19494]
[New LWP 19485]
[New LWP 19484]
[New LWP 19479]
[New LWP 19504]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
Core was generated by `/usr/lib/kodi/kodi.bin'.
Program terminated with signal SIGSEGV, Segmentation fault.
#0 0x0000000000aa8e86 in EPG::CGUIEPGGridContainer::UpdateItems() ()
.
.
.
.
..
18:55:25 T:140030574688192 DEBUG: ------ Window Deinit (Settings.xml) ------
18:55:25 T:140030574688192 DEBUG: CGUIWindowManager:
reviousWindow: Activate new
18:55:25 T:140030574688192 DEBUG: ------ Window Init (Home.xml) ------
18:55:25 T:140030574688192 DEBUG: SECTION:LoadDLL(special://xbmcbin/system/ImageLib-x86_64-linux.so)
18:55:25 T:140030574688192 DEBUG: Loading: /usr/lib/kodi/system/ImageLib-x86_64-linux.so
18:55:25 T:140027266852608 DEBUG: AddOnLog: MythTV PVR Client: RunHouseKeeping
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etDriveSpace
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: (CPPMyth)SendCommand: QUERY_FREE_SPACE_SUMMARY
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: (CPPMyth)RcvMessageLength: 23
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etNumChannels
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etTimersAmount
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etRecordingsAmount
18:55:26 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etDeletedRecordingsAmount
18:55:26 T:140030574688192 DEBUG: Keyboard: scancode: 0x71, sym: 0x0114, unicode: 0x0000, modifier: 0x0
18:55:26 T:140030574688192 DEBUG: OnKey: left (0xf082) pressed, action is Left
18:55:26 T:140027266852608 DEBUG: AddOnLog: MythTV PVR Client: RunHouseKeeping
18:55:27 T:140030574688192 DEBUG: Keyboard: scancode: 0x71, sym: 0x0114, unicode: 0x0000, modifier: 0x0
18:55:27 T:140030574688192 DEBUG: OnKey: left (0xf082) pressed, action is Left
18:55:27 T:140030574688192 DEBUG: Keyboard: scancode: 0x71, sym: 0x0114, unicode: 0x0000, modifier: 0x0
18:55:27 T:140030574688192 DEBUG: OnKey: left (0xf082) pressed, action is Left
18:55:27 T:140030574688192 DEBUG: Keyboard: scancode: 0x71, sym: 0x0114, unicode: 0x0000, modifier: 0x0
18:55:27 T:140030574688192 DEBUG: OnKey: left (0xf082) pressed, action is Left
18:55:27 T:140027266852608 DEBUG: AddOnLog: MythTV PVR Client: RunHouseKeeping
18:55:29 T:140030574688192 DEBUG: Previous line repeats 1 times.
18:55:29 T:140030574688192 DEBUG: Keyboard: scancode: 0x71, sym: 0x0114, unicode: 0x0000, modifier: 0x0
18:55:29 T:140030574688192 DEBUG: OnKey: left (0xf082) pressed, action is Left
18:55:29 T:140030574688192 DEBUG: Keyboard: scancode: 0x74, sym: 0x0112, unicode: 0x0000, modifier: 0x0
18:55:29 T:140030574688192 DEBUG: OnKey: down (0xf081) pressed, action is Down
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etDriveSpace
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: (CPPMyth)SendCommand: QUERY_FREE_SPACE_SUMMARY
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: (CPPMyth)RcvMessageLength: 23
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etNumChannels
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etTimersAmount
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etRecordingsAmount
18:55:29 T:140026226616064 DEBUG: AddOnLog: MythTV PVR Client: GetDeletedRecordingsAmount
18:55:29 T:140030574688192 DEBUG: Keyboard: scancode: 0x72, sym: 0x0113, unicode: 0x0000, modifier: 0x0
18:55:29 T:140030574688192 DEBUG: OnKey: right (0xf083) pressed, action is Right
18:55:29 T:140027266852608 DEBUG: AddOnLog: MythTV PVR Client: RunHouseKeeping
18:55:30 T:140030574688192 DEBUG: Keyboard: scancode: 0x24, sym: 0x000d, unicode: 0x000d, modifier: 0x0
18:55:30 T:140030574688192 DEBUG: OnKey: return (0xf00d) pressed, action is Select
18:55:30 T:140030574688192 DEBUG: Activating window ID: 10617
18:55:30 T:140030574688192 DEBUG: ------ Window Deinit (Home.xml) ------
18:55:30 T:140030574688192 DEBUG: ------ Window Init (MyPVRGuide.xml) ------
18:55:30 T:140030574688192 INFO: Loading skin file: MyPVRGuide.xml, load type: KEEP_IN_MEMORY
18:55:30 T:140030574688192 DEBUG: CGUIEPGGridContainer - SetStartEnd - start=22/07/2015 5:30:00 PM end=26/07/2015 5:30:00 PM
############### END LOG FILE ################
############ END Kodi CRASH LOG #############